Strictly speaking, you don't license "Logos 4 for Windows" or "Logos 4 for Mac". You license a collection of resources (a Logos 4 base package) that you can use on Windows, Mac, iOS (iPhone/iPad/iPod Touch) or biblia.com. Not all resources are available on the iOS devices and/or biblia.com.Timothy Shrimpton said:If you own Logos 4 for Windows, is there any charge to use the Mac version?

David N DeMott said:How did you go about installing your logos mac version without loosing anything. I have my resources on an external drive and wondered if I had to do something to make them accessible to the new Mac version once I install it.
Just download the Mac version from www.logos.com/logos4mac, install it and log in. The program will automatically download your resources onto your Mac and then the your library will be indexed. (That part takes a few hours or so depending on the speed of your Mac.) That's all there is to it.
You can keep your Windows copy installed and use it, and you can install it on as many of your PCs or Macs as you wish, as long as YOU are the one using it.
